This image was inspired by background paintings done by Eyvind Earle for the Walt Disney classic, Sleeping Beauty. The story behind this image is about a boy playing in the snow, watching how his leaf-parachute dances in the wind, and making the most of a situation that most people would not find joyful. I attempted to produce the simple yet detailed brush strokes seen in the Sleeping Beauty film. I also focused on keeping strong silhouettes, while creating movement for the eye to dance around the picture in theme of the dancing leaf-parachute.
